 "The Untouchables" is a crime drama film directed by Brian De Palma and released in 1987. The movie is based on the television series of the same name and tells the story of law enforcement efforts to bring down the notorious gangster Al Capone during the Prohibition era in Chicago.



The film features an ensemble cast, including Kevin Costner as Eliot Ness, a federal agent leading the charge against Capone, and Robert De Niro as Al Capone. Sean Connery won an Academy Award for Best Supporting Actor for his role as Jim Malone, a seasoned and streetwise Irish-American cop who joins Ness's team. The cast also includes Andy Garcia and Charles Martin Smith.


"The Untouchables" is known for its intense action sequences, stylish direction by Brian De Palma, and Ennio Morricone's memorable musical score. The film received critical acclaim for its performances, particularly Sean Connery's, and its engaging portrayal of the battle between law enforcement and organized crime during a pivotal period in American history.


While the film takes creative liberties with historical events, "The Untouchables" has remained a popular and well-regarded entry in the crime drama genre.
